How to build smart, zero carbon buildings - and why it matters

How to build smart, zero carbon buildings - and why it matters

Speaker: Professor Lam Khee Poh 8 Sep 2021

Reducing carbon emissions in buildings will be critical to achieving the Paris climate goals and achieving net zero emissions by 2050. 

Read about how efficient, zero carbon buildings take advantage of available, cost-effective technology to reduce emissions while increasing health, equity and economic prosperity in local communities.
